 1. Mechanical properties of the base material. Tensile strength and yield strength of the weld metal should equal or exceed that of the base material. Ductility and toughness at low temperatures may btassairmanifold also be important. High-temperature service requires btassairmanifold resistance to creep. Shock loading requires btassairmanifold and btassairmanifold impact resistance. In general, weld metal should match base-material properties.2. Composition of the base material.For stainless steels, low alloy steels, nickel and copper alloys, and materials btassairmanifold that serve in corrosive atmospheres, chemical composition is important. Low-hydrogen btassairmanifold types. These basic-coated electrodes, EXX15, EXX16, EXX18, EXX28, and EXX48, are formulated with low moisture-retaining coatings and manufactured to contain low levels of hydrogen. Hydrogen-controlled electrodes minimize risk of hydrogen-induced cold cracking btassairmanifold when welding high-tensile steels on restrained structures. Fabricators use these electrodes to reduce or avoid the need for pre- or postweld heat treatment to drive hydrogen from weld metal. Weldmetal diffusible hydrogen content varies from 1 to 16 ml/100 g. Optional designators H16, H8, and H4 set decreasing limits on hydrogen content in deposited weld metal. An optional electrode designator, ''R'', indicates an electrode that is moisture resistant; it will not absorb water in excess of a specified limit after btassairmanifold exposure to humidity.
